A Historical Foundation: Russia as a Hemp Superpower
To understand the modern-day Russian cannabis landscape, one should recall to the 18th and 19th centuries. Under the reign of Peter the Great, Russia ended up being the world's leading producer of industrial hemp. The plant was necessary for the period's worldwide economy, offering the fiber needed for the ropes and sails of the British Royal Navy and other European fleets.

By the mid-19th century, hemp represented a substantial part of Russia's exports. The Russian climate-- particularly in southern areas-- is preferably suited for the cultivation of Cannabis sativa. While this production was concentrated on commercial energy, the plant's presence was common, deeply embedding it into the agricultural material of the nation.

Russia maintains a zero-tolerance policy toward the recreational and medical use of cannabis including high levels of THC. The legal landscape is mainly governed by the Russian Criminal Code and the Administrative Code.
Table 1: Legal Thresholds and Consequences in RussiaAmount TypeAmount (Grams)Legal ClassificationProspective ConsequencesConsiderable Amount6g to 25gAdministrative/CriminalFines or as much as 3 years jail timeBig Amount25g to 100gCriminal (Article 228)3 to 10 years imprisonmentParticularly LargeOver 100gBad Guy (Article 228.1)10 to 20 years or life jail time
The infamous "Article 228" of the Russian Criminal Code is often described as the "People's Article," as it represents a considerable percentage of the nation's prison population. Because of these risks, the market for premium cannabis remains totally underground and highly discreet.
Industrial Hemp vs. Premium Cannabis
While high-THC cannabis is strictly prohibited, Russia has actually seen a revival in commercial hemp. The federal government allows the growing of registered hemp varieties that contain less than 0.1% THC. Is medical cannabis legal in Russia?
No. Russia does not presently have a medical cannabis program. All types of cannabis containing THC are prohibited for medical usage.

5. Does Russia produce its own cannabis seeds?
Russia has several institutes, such as the Vavilov Institute of Plant Industry, that preserve among the world's biggest collections of hemp genetics. Nevertheless, these are strictly for industrial, low-THC use.
